Fires reported at markets in Burundi and Burkina Faso

Multiple fires were reported in commercial areas across Burundi and Burkina Faso on Tuesday, August 25, 2026.

In Burundi, a fire broke out at the Kinindo market in the Mugere commune of Bujumbura province. The blaze, which began around 10:30 a.m., heavily damaged the mattress section before spreading to other areas. Alain Ndikumana, the Minister of Finance, Budget, and the Digital Economy, stated that investigations will be conducted to determine the cause, noting that recent fires in Bujumbura suggest the possibility of non-accidental origins. Authorities are currently assessing the extent of the material losses and identifying affected traders.

In Burkina Faso, a fire erupted in a series of warehouses in the Sector 01 district of Bobo-Dioulasso. The Second Fire and Rescue Company (CIS2) and ASECNA teams worked together to contain the flames, preventing the fire from spreading to nearby residential and commercial infrastructure. While the exact cause of the Bobo-Dioulasso fire remains unspecified, the National Firefighters Brigade has issued reminders regarding safety protocols for product storage and handling.
